Do I need headlight deflectors for my LED lights?

  • 4 weeks later...

I don't when coming to UK as I simply use the thumb wheel by my light switch to lower my headlamps. Some can be adjusted through the menu in the infotainment system

As the original post was over a month ago, this may help others. There may be a setting in the menus for left hand and right hand running. There is on our Karoq and may be similar on a Kamiq.
